Apple Launches Payments Platform

Apple announces Apple Pay, which allows users to pay for items using the new iPhone 6, iPhone 6 Plus or new wearable technology known as Apple Watch. Apple Pay will work with the three major payment networks – American Express, MasterCard and Visa. Payments will be available in the U.S. in October and work is under way to take the technology worldwide soon, Apple says. Experts say Apple’s announcement may be the catalyst to legitimize near field communication technology and improve security. Apple Watch will be released Sept. 19, as well as Apple Pay – coming early next year.”]
